In prior work we implemented both a tc and dc that achieved modest performance. Steve stedman programmer and database consultant email. This book is an excellent complement to performance tuning books focusing on sql queries, and provides the other half of what you need to know by focusing on configuring the instances on which missioncritical queries are executed. Sql performance problems are as old as sql itselfsome might even say that sql is inherently slow. Sql server query performance tuning printed book only sql server execution plans free pdf, or you can buy the printed book jonathan kehayias and erin stellato wrote an ebook on wait statistics, which are critical for perf tuning a workload. With high performance mysql, youll learn advanced techniques for everything from designing schemas, indexes, and queries to tuning your mysql server, operating system, and hardware to their fullest potential.
Covers sql server instanceconfiguration for optimal performance helps in configuring for virtualized environments such as vmware provides guidance toward monitoring and ongoing diagnostics design and configure sql server instances and databases in support of highthroughput applications that are. Performance tuning for sql server brent ozar unlimited. Reuse in the procedure cache allows queries and procedures to run faster. Apr 25, 2020 sql server stores important information in memory, such as table structures, execution plans, and cached queries. Some of this information rarely changes, so it becomes a target for the paging file. Performance sql server consistently leads in performance benchmarks, such as tpce and tpch, and in realworld application performance. Download high performance sql server the go faster book. Sql server technical e book series sql server performance. Download your free copy of 45 database performance tips for developers to see the sql server performance tips and tricks recommended by some of the smartest minds in the simple talk community, including sql server mvps. The book is revised to cowl the very latest in effectivity optimization choices and strategies, notably along with the newlyadded, inmemory database choices beforehand acknowledged beneath the code determine enterprise hekaton. Improve your applications database performance, and make your dbas day. Microsoft sql server 2012 highperformance tsql using window. High availability solutions this topic introduces sql server high availability solutions that improve the availability of servers or databases.
A search query can be a title of the book, a name of the author, isbn or anything else. Optimize your queriesand obtain simple and elegant solutions to a variety of problemsusing window functions in transactsql. Sql server books high performance techniques from sentryone. Tim is a sql server mvp, and has been working with sql server for over ten years. This book is a deep dive into perhaps the singlemost important facet of good performance. May 15, 20 performance sql server consistently leads in performance benchmarks, such as tpce and tpch, and in realworld application performance. Chapter 02 faster querying with sql server 1 10 tb tpch nonclustered result as of 9th november, 2017. The book you are about to read represents an entirely new modality of book publishing and a. Tuning options for sql server when running in high. Grant fritcheys book sql server query performance tuning is the reply to your sql server query effectivity points.
This document discusses things to consider when architecting a large, highperformance relational data warehouse, especially one that is host to unpredictable ad hoc queries. How to tune indexes and make sql server queries go faster. This is now the top tpce result in both performance and price performance. Popular sql tuning books meet your next favorite book.
Apply powerful window functions in tsqland increase the performance and speed of your queries. Typically, you use these trace flags when sql server is running in high performance workloads. With sql server 2016, performance is enhanced with a number of new technologies, including inmemory enhancements, query store, and temporal support, to name a few. The book begins in the shallow waters with explanations of the types of. Although this might have been true in the early days of sql, it is definitely not true anymore. The go faster book by benjamin nevarez accessibility books library as well as its powerful features, including thousands and thousands of title from favorite author, along with the capability to read or download hundreds of boos on your pc or smartphone in minutes. Recommended sql server books, 2020 edition brent ozar. High performance sql server is based on sql server 2016, although most of its content can be applied to prior versions of the product. Sql server technical ebook series sql server performance.
Understanding how sql server works internally, is the key to making configuration changes to improve performance. The structure of the book is tailormade for developers. B01n2khvaz design and configure sql server instances and databases in support of highthroughput applications that are missioncritical and provide consistent response times in the face. Beginning sql server reporting services ebook, pdf. A high availability solution masks the effects of a hardware or software failure and maintains the availability of applications so that the perceived downtime for users is minimized. If this information gets moved to the paging file, sql server performance can degrade. Memory is generally the most critical factor in sql server performance. Nov 03, 2017 result3 using sql server 2017 and windows server 2016. You can always make an application run just a little bit faster, so its important. We recently built a high performance dc the bwtree key value store that. The book primarily focuses on sql server 2016, but much of it is applicable to earlier versions of sql server. Enuscntntebookdbmcsqlserverperformancefasterquerying. Download high performance sql server the go faster book ebook free in pdf and epub format. I wrote this article about this repository since its one of the best way to test jdbc, jpa, hibernate or even jooq code.
With only 200 pages, this book is not overwhelming to read. This book is sold subject to the condition that it shall not, by way of trade or. Performance tuning with sql server dynamic management. Microsoft sql server 2012 highperformance tsql using. Microsoft sql server performance tuning, live duration. Its a big topic, and it takes up its own tip later in this article. The deuteronomy architecture provides a clean separation of transaction functionality performed in a transaction component, or tc from data management functionality performed in a data component, or dc. Learn to configure sql server and design your databases to support a. This chapter is great as it starts from the beginning. High performance transactions in deuteronomy microsoft. The sql language is perhaps the most successful fourthgeneration. The goal of this short first chapter is to provide a brief, highlevel overview of the.
We recently built a high performance dc the bwtree key value store that achieves very high performance on modern hardware and is currently shipping as an indexing and storage layer in a number of microsoft systems. This is now the top tpce result in both performance and priceperformance. High performance sql server is based on sql server 2016, althoughmost of its content can be applied to prior versions of the product. B01n2khvaz design and configure sql server instances and databases in support of highthroughput applications that are missioncritical and provide consistent response. Download high performance data warehouse with sql server 2005. Pdf high performance sql server the go faster book. In my mind, any conversation about performance has to take into consideration the development process and functional requirements, but people find that boring. Below is a chapterbychapter exploration of the topics covered. Four tips on boosting sql server scalability storage is the next thing youll look at. Surprisingly, a lot of sql servers default settings can lead to bad performance. Optimize your queriesand obtain simple and elegant solutions to a variety of. Performance tuning the procedure cache reduces waste on the sql server.
This book is an excellent complement to performance tuning books focusing on sql queries, and provides the other half of what you need to know by focusing on configuring the instances on which missioncritical. High performance sql server the go faster book pdfcsdn. Or, if you prefer videos, you can watch this presentation on youtube. He is the cofounder of sql cruise, llc, a training company for sql server specializing in deepdive sessions for small groups, hosted in exotic and alternative locations throughout the world. The book you are about to read represents an entirely new modality of book publishing and a major first in the publishing industry. High performance sql server the go faster book benjamin. Sql server stores important information in memory, such as table structures, execution plans, and cached queries. This guide also teaches you safe and practical ways to scale applications through replication, load balancing, high availability, and. Mar 14, 2017 mr benjamin nevarez bio below was kind enough to send me a copy of his latest book, high performance sql server. If a query can find the data it needs in memory, it may execute hundreds of times faster than if it has to go to disk. Sql server performance tuning using wait statistics. Performance tuning for sql server sql server consulting.
The go faster book book online at best prices in india on. Download full high performance sql server the go faster book book in pdf, epub, mobi and all ebook format. Faster data growth demands faster access 02 faster querying with sql server 03 database performance 04 query performance 05 additional performance improving tools and features 06 setting the standard for speed and performance content sql. High performance sql server the go faster book pdf csdn. Download high performance data warehouse with sql server. The highperformance java persistence book and video course code examples. This repository accompanies high performance sql server by benjamin nevarez apress, 2016 download the files as a zip using the green button, or clone the repository to your machine using git. Read download high performance sql server the go faster. Sql server holds a worldrecord 1 tb tpch benchmark4 result nonclustered for sql server on red hat enterprise linux.
You can use these trace flags to improve the performance of sql server. Development process is the problem not the server 5. High availability solutions this topic introduces sql server highavailability solutions that improve the availability of servers or databases. This article describes various trace flags as tuning options in microsoft sql server 2005 and sql server 2008. High performance sql server the go faster book 2016 pdf gooner publisher. Kindle ebooks can be read on any device with the free kindle app. Aug 19, 2019 this article describes various trace flags as tuning options in microsoft sql server 2005 and sql server 2008. Benjamin nevarez high performance sql server the go faster book benjamin nevarez santa clarita, california, usa any source code or other supplementary materials referenced by the author in this text selection from high performance sql server. Download your free copy of 45 database performance tips for developers to see the sql server performance tips and tricks recommended by some of the smartest minds in the simple talk community, including sql server mvps then make it effortless to work with sql, with a 28day free trial of sql prompt. High performance techniques for sql server in these books, you will find useful, handpicked articles that will help give insight into some of your most vexing performance problems. High performance sql server the go faster book 2016. Besides free ebooks, you also download free magazines or submit page 331. Download sql server query performance tuning pdf ebook. This is now the top tpce result in both performance and price.
Design and configure sql server instances and databases in support of highthroughput applications that are missioncritical and provide consistent response times in the face of variations in user numbers and selection from high performance sql server. Read high performance sql server the go faster book online, read in mobile or kindle. Freeebooks is an online source for free ebook downloads, ebook resources and ebook authors. While adding memory will almost always help sql server performance, there are limits to how much memory a processor can use therefore optimizing the usage of. Best practices to maximize sql server performance contents solidstate storage devices for sql server. These first two are both overviews of performance tuning, covering wide swaths of the tools built into sql server to assess its existing performance and make it go faster. High performance sql server ebook, pdf nevarez, benjamin. Plus, if youre looking to unplug, reading books is a good way to pry yourself away from the screen. Exam ref 70764 administering a sql database infrastructure. These articles were written by several of the sql server industrys leading experts, including aaron bertrand, paul white, paul randal, jonathan kehayias, erin. Faster data growth demands faster access 02 faster querying with sql server 03 database performance 04 query performance 05 additional performanceimproving tools and features 06 setting the standard for speed and performance content sql.
Performance tuning with sql server dynamic management views. Improve your applications database performance, and make. Welcome to the definitive guide to sql server performance optimization. Sep 19, 2007 this document discusses things to consider when architecting a large, high performance relational data warehouse, especially one that is host to unpredictable ad hoc queries.
Chapter 02 faster querying with sql server 1 10tb tpch nonclustered result as of november 9. The discussion includes some of the new features of sql server 2005 and considerations to take into account when using these features. A highavailability solution masks the effects of a hardware or software failure and maintains the availability of applications so. I will list the chapters below with a brief description of whats in each. The highperformance java persistence book and video. High performance sql server high performance sql server. The right of benjamin nevarez to be identified as the author of this work has been asserted by him in. The networking protocols used by sql server tcpip, named pipes, via, etc. Nevertheless sql performance problems are still commonplace. Its a free health check that catches many common performance bottlenecks.
Chapter 4, index selection, shows how sql server can speed up your queries and. High performance sql server the go faster book pdfsqlserver. Books to learn sql server performance tuning and database. High performance transactions in deuteronomy microsoft research. The go faster book now with oreilly online learning.
879 1244 29 148 1383 516 600 811 1051 253 1513 92 1637 560 817 1637 706 423 333 486 1016 1358 1174 1466 143 652 1456 1180 691